Frequently Asked Questions

The story follows Mo Fan, a regular high school student who suddenly finds himself transported to a parallel world where magic is real and society revolves around mastering elemental spells. At first, he's just trying to survive in this unfamiliar place, but after discovering his unique dual-element affinity—something rare in this world—he starts climbing the ranks of magical academies. The series blends school life with high-stakes battles against supernatural creatures, and Mo Fan's growth from an underdog to a powerhouse is incredibly satisfying. What I love is how he uses his modern-world knowledge to outsmart opponents, like when he combines fire and lightning in ways no one expects.

Later arcs expand the scope dramatically, with ancient beasts threatening cities and political intrigue among mage factions. The pacing can feel uneven—some school arcs drag—but the payoffs are worth it, especially when Mo Fan's rag-tag group of friends gets involved. The anime adaptation captures the flashy spell duels really well, though the manhua digs deeper into the system's lore, like how shadow magic ties into vampiric legends. It's basically 'Harry Potter' meets 'Battle Through the Heavens,' but with a protagonist who's more street-smart than chosen-one.
